    Just looked at 10 random schools to see how they do it. Here are the results.

    Schools that have baseball seats you can buy without donations: LSUAMBR, Houston, Tulane, Southern Miss, LTUR, Arkansas, Rice, Alabama, South Alabama, Auburn.

    Schools that will require donations to purchase season tickets: Louisiana.

    Yes, the 10 random schools do not require donations for all season tickets. The only one that does is us.
